Its defining technical specifications include:\u003c\/p\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eBrand \u0026amp; Model:\u003c\/strong\u003e Bently Nevada \u003cstrong\u003e\u003cspan style=\"color: #2a9d8f;\"\u003e330101-00-79-10-02-CN\u003c\/span\u003e\u003c\/strong\u003e (3300 XL Series)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eProbe Type:\u003c\/strong\u003e 8 mm diameter, 3\/8-24 UNF thread, without armor\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eOverall Case Length:\u003c\/strong\u003e 7.9 inches (200 mm) - Extended design option\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eLinear Measurement Range:\u003c\/strong\u003e 2.0 mm (80 mils), from 0.25 mm to 2.3 mm from target\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eRecommended Gap Setting:\u003c\/strong\u003e 1.27 mm (50 mils) for radial vibration, outputting -9 Vdc\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eSensitivity (Scale Factor):\u003c\/strong\u003e 7.87 V\/mm (200 mV\/mil) ±5% for standard 5m systems\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eLinearity (Deviation):\u003c\/strong\u003e Better than ±0.025 mm (±1 mil) over the linear range\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eProbe Tip Material:\u003c\/strong\u003e Durable, molded Polyphenylene Sulfide (PPS)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eCase Material:\u003c\/strong\u003e AISI 303\/304 Stainless Steel\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ch3\u003e\u003cstrong\u003ePerformance \u0026amp; Environmental Ratings\u003c\/strong\u003e\u003c\/h3\u003e\n\u003cp\u003eDesigned for challenging industrial environments, this long probe offers uncompromised durability and reliability.\u003c\/p\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eStandard Operating Temperature:\u003c\/strong\u003e -52°C to +177°C (-62°F to +350°F)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eExtended Temperature Option:\u003c\/strong\u003e Probe tip rated up to +218°C (+425°F)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eHumidity Resistance:\u003c\/strong\u003e Less than 3% output change after 56 days at 93% RH\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eMechanical Strength:\u003c\/strong\u003e Patented CableLoc ensures 330 N (75 lbf) cable pull-off resistance\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eSealing:\u003c\/strong\u003e Features a Viton® O-ring for effective differential pressure sealing\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eRobust Design:\u003c\/strong\u003e 8mm diameter provides superior coil protection and case strength\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ch3\u003e\u003cstrong\u003eElectrical \u0026amp; System Integration Data\u003c\/strong\u003e\u003c\/h3\u003e\n\u003cp\u003eEnsure accurate system performance by following these integration guidelines for the long-case probe.\u003c\/p\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eNominal Probe Resistance (RPROBE):\u003c\/strong\u003e 7.59 Ω ±0.50 Ω for the 1.0-meter integrated cable\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eExtension Cable Capacitance:\u003c\/strong\u003e 69.9 pF per meter (21.3 pF per foot), typical\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eField Wiring Recommendation:\u003c\/strong\u003e Use 3-conductor shielded triad cable (0.2-1.5 mm² or 16-24 AWG)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eMaximum Field Wiring Distance:\u003c\/strong\u003e 305 meters (1000 feet) between probe and monitor\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eConnector Type:\u003c\/strong\u003e Miniature coaxial ClickLoc connector (Option 02)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eTotal Cable Length:\u003c\/strong\u003e 1.0 meter (3.3 feet) from probe tip to connector\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ch3\u003e\u003cstrong\u003eFrequently Asked Questions (FAQ)\u003c\/strong\u003e\u003c\/h3\u003e\n\u003cp\u003e\u003cstrong\u003eQ: Is this a genuine Bently Nevada 3300 XL long probe?\u003c\/strong\u003e\u003cbr\u003e\u003cstrong\u003eA:\u003c\/strong\u003e Yes.
